Dom Brown not traded, but breakup with girlfriend aired over Instagram

Rumors started swirling on Twitter on Thursday afternoon that Dom Brown, the Phillies struggling 27-year-old outfielder, had been traded to the Cleveland Indians. Turns out these rumors were started by a fake account setup to look like ESPN's Jerry Crasnick. But this fake Twitter user wasn't basing his fake report off of nothing.


Brown had posted an ambiguous Instagram photo that may have led one to believe he had been traded.


It was a simple photo of Dom in a suit sitting in the clubhouse before a game. The caption along with it read, 'It's been great . Time to move forward. Thanks for everything #love'


What was he moving on from? Most assumed Philadelphia and the Phillies given the clubhouse context. Matt Gelb recently reported the team would likely attempt to trade him this offseason. But who gets traded in the middle of September?


As it turns out, after some more Internet sleuthing, Brown was talking about ending his relationship with his girlfriend, Steph Gayle. The two have a young baby girl together, London Skyler, and were even pictured on the team's official Instagram account on Mother's Day with the 'girlfriend' label.


Brown made the breakup clear in the comment section a couple of hours later to clear up any confusion, it seems.



You can see the two pictured together all over Gayle's Instagram account, as recently as three week's ago at Cole Hamels' Diamonds and Denim event.


Following along in the comment section of the original photo gets very interesting when a user with the name 'steph.gayle' left a comment saying she was blocked from commenting as 'steph_gayle.' The latter being the account of the mother of Dom's child. 'Steph.Gayle' was not pleased.


Not pleased one bit.



So to recap: Dom Brown is still a Phillie for now, appears officially single (which may have transpired via Instagram), the apparent mother of his child aired plenty of dirty laundry, and social media is never a good place to do any of this.
